2. Mastering Oil Changes: The Lifeblood of Your Sportsbike
Why Oil Changes Matter
Oil lubricates your engine’s moving parts, reduces friction, dissipates heat, and prevents corrosion. Failure to change your oil routinely will degrade engine performance and can cause irreversible damage.
Optimal Intervals and Techniques
Refer to your manual for manufacturer-recommended oil change intervals, typically every 3,000 to 5,000 miles or every 6 months. Use high-grade synthetic oils designed for high-revving engines typical of sportsbikes.
Drain the warm oil to ensure thorough removal of contaminants. Replace the oil filter simultaneously to prevent dirty oil circulation.
Pro Tip
Always record oil change dates and mileage to maintain an accurate service history that aids in resale value and diagnosing performance issues.

3. Tire Care: The Foundation of Safety and Handling
Checking Tire Pressure and Tread
Proper tire pressure supports optimal grip, fuel efficiency, and handling response. Use a digital gauge to check pressures weekly, adjusting for weather conditions and load. Inspect tread depth regularly; replace tires when the tread wears down to the wear bars or below 1.6 mm.
Handling Wear and Rotation
Sportsbikes have different wear patterns on front and rear tires due to riding dynamics. While front tire rotation isn’t feasible, monitor rear tire wear closely and replace as needed. Uneven wear may signal alignment or suspension issues.

4. Brakes and Safety Inspections: Stopping Power Matters
Inspecting Brake Pads and Rotors
Brake pads should be checked monthly for wear; replace them if thickness is below manufacturer specs (usually 2-3 mm). Rotors must be inspected for scoring, warping, or excessive wear.
Brake Fluid Maintenance
Brake fluid absorbs moisture over time, reducing performance and increasing corrosion risks. Change fluid every 1–2 years or as recommended by your service manual. Use the correct DOT rating specified for your brakes.
Safety Check Protocol
Before every ride, perform a functional brake test in a safe area. Listen for unusual noises during braking and feel for any vibration or softness in the lever or pedal.

5. Chain and Sprocket Care: Ensuring Smooth Power Delivery
Cleaning and Lubrication
To maximize drivetrain efficiency, clean your chain and sprockets regularly, especially after wet or dusty rides. Use non-corrosive chain cleaners and motorcycle-specific lubricants. Avoid over-lubrication to prevent attracting grime.
Tension and Adjustment
Chains should have a specified amount of slack (usually 20-30 mm) to avoid excessive wear or derailment. Check tension monthly and adjust with the motorcycle’s tensioners, ensuring wheels are aligned properly.
Signs of Replacement
Replace chain and sprockets as a set if you notice stiff links, excessive elongation, or teeth wear on sprockets. Neglecting these parts can lead to power loss and safety hazards.

6. Air Filter Maintenance for Engine Efficiency
Why Clean Air Matters
Dirty air filters restrict airflow, causing inefficient combustion, reduced power, and increased fuel consumption. In dusty conditions, inspect filters more often than the recommended interval.
Cleaning vs Replacing
Foam or cotton filters can often be cleaned and oiled, but paper filters require replacement. Always adhere to the manufacturer’s instructions for service frequency and method.
Installation Tips
Ensure the air filter is properly seated with no gaps or leaks to prevent unfiltered air ingestion, which can damage your engine. After servicing, monitor your throttle response as an indicator of proper installation.

7. Coolant System Checks: Preventing Overheating
Why Coolant Is Critical
Maintaining the right coolant level and mixture prevents your sportsbike’s engine from overheating and freezing. Coolant also inhibits rust and corrosion inside the radiator and engine.
Checking and Replacing Coolant
Check coolant levels monthly, topping off with the correct mixture of antifreeze and water as specified. Flush and replace coolant every 2 years or per manufacturer’s schedule.
Inspecting Cooling Components
Regularly inspect hoses, clamps, and radiator for leaks or damage. Pay attention to overheating signs such as temperature gauge spikes or steam from the radiator.

8. Battery Maintenance: Ensuring Reliable Starts
Signs Your Battery Needs Attention
If your sportsbike hesitates or fails to start, or the electrical systems act erratically, your battery may be failing. Check voltage regularly; a healthy 12V battery should read around 12.6 volts at rest.
Maintenance Tips
Keep battery terminals clean and tight, free of corrosion. Use a trickle charger if the bike is stored for extended periods to maintain charge without overcharging.
When to Replace and Upgrade
If your battery is over 3-5 years old or fails load tests despite charging, replace it with a high-quality lithium-ion or AGM battery for improved performance and weight savings.

9. Electrical and Lighting Systems: Visibility and Communication
Routine Checks
Before every ride, check all lights: headlights, brake lights, turn signals, and indicators. Functioning lights are vital both for your safety and legal compliance.
Fixing Common Electrical Issues
Corroded connections or blown fuses are common culprits for lighting failures. Keep a small toolkit with spare fuses for roadside fixes and consult wiring diagrams when troubleshooting.
Aftermarket Lighting and Compliance
Upgrading to LED lighting improves visibility and battery life, but ensure your modifications comply with local regulations to avoid legal penalties.

11. Winter Storage and Off-Season Tips
Preparing Your Bike
Before storage, clean your bike thoroughly to remove dirt and prevent corrosion. Top off fluids, charge the battery fully, and inflate tires to proper pressure to avoid flat spots.
Storage Environment
Store your sportsbike in a dry, climate-controlled space covered with a breathable motorcycle cover. Avoid direct sunlight and excessive humidity.
Periodic Checks
Start your bike every 3-4 weeks and idly run the engine to circulate fluids and maintain battery condition. Check tire pressure and look for leaks or pest infestation in storage areas.

FAQ: Your Sportsbike Maintenance Questions Answered
How often should I perform routine maintenance checks on my sportsbike?
Basic checks like tire pressure and lights should be done weekly or before every ride. Oil changes and fluid checks should follow manufacturer recommendations, typically between 3,000-5,000 miles or every 6 months.
Can I service my sportsbike myself or should I go to a professional?
Many routine tasks like oil changes, tire pressure checks, and chain maintenance can be done by owners with basic tools and knowledge. However, complex issues, brake servicing, and engine tuning are best handled by certified mechanics.
What are the risks of skipping routine maintenance?
Neglecting upkeep can lead to decreased performance, premature parts wear, increased fuel consumption, and critical safety hazards such as brake failure or tire blowouts.
What type of oil is best for sportsbikes?
High-quality synthetic motor oils designed for high-RPM engines are recommended. Always consult your owner’s manual for the correct viscosity and specifications.
